To have shoes that fit correctly, both of your feet should be measured. Quite a few people have one foot that is a little big bigger than the other. For the best comfort, find shoes that fit your bigger foot.

Never purchase shoes without trying them on; don’t forget to walk around. If you don’t try them out, you’ll have no idea that they don’t fit right. Walk with different sizes on your feet until you find the right one.

Pick shoes that feel comfortable to wear. Your shoes are important for protecting your feet. Shoes that are not properly fitted can cause pain and damage to your feet. Since this may cause future foot-related problems, only purchase shoes that are comfortable and that fit your feet correctly.

Great shoes should feel comfortable from the first time you put them on. If you try on shoes and they don’t feel good, find another pair. Breaking in new shoes can make your feet develop problems.

Children’s shoes should always be about a half size larger than they measure. Have about your thumbs width from your kid’s large toe and to the shoe’s end. Although the shoe will be a little big, it won’t be too large and they have some extra room to grow. Ask the staff at the store for help.

Don’t buy painful shoes hoping they will fit your feet better after wearing them multiple times. Usually, this is ineffective and you’re stuck with a pricey pair of shoes. If your shoes need to be stretched to accommodate bunions, this could be an exception.

Running Shoes

Keep track of the mileage you put on your favorite running shoes. Your shoes are going to deal with a lot of wear and tear thanks to running. You should buy new running shoes after 400 miles since your shoes will no longer provide you with the support you need once they get too old. Jot it down after each run to know when they need replaced.

Be sure you wait some until it’s later in the day when you’re shoe shopping. Feet swell as the hours pass. Thus, you ought to shop for shoes in the afternoon or evening. This means the shoes will fit throughout the day.

If you buy shoes made of suede or leather, be sure to waterproof them. This protects your investment when you walk through the snow and rain. The better you take care of shoes, the longer you’ll have them.

If you’re someone who has to get high heels because they make your legs look longer, try to make sure they’re not damaging your feet too much. Use some cushioned inserts that are made to wear with heels. The shoes will feel better throughout the day and could also help you avoid damaging your toes.

There needs to be a half an inch or so between the shoe’s end and your foot. This can be easily measured by turning your thumb sideways and pressing on your foot’s top. Ask for a few sizes if a shoe is too far or close to end of that shoe.

Get a fitting at your local store that sells running shoes to make sure you are fitted correctly. There are quite a few different shoes for running that can help you depending on your body’s type and how you run. This means you need to figure out what’s going to work the best for you.

Don’t buy shoes at night. It sounds odd, but your feet swell as you’re walking about on them all day, and you have to be certain your shoes are going to fit when the sun goes down. You may end up owning shoes that are painful by day’s end unless you are able to take them off before then.

If you are getting shoes for a child, get shoes that use velcro. Velcro help protect children from accidentally tripping over their shoelaces. Shoes that use Velcro to fasten are easier for children and will cost about the same as any other type of fastener on shoes.
